Fatigue overview Introduction to Fatigue analysis Fatigue is the failure of a component after several repetitive load cycles. As a one-time occurrence, the load is not dangerous in itself. Over time the alternating load is able to break the structure anyway. It is estimated that between 50 and 90 % of product failures is caused by Fatigue , and based on this fact, Fatigue evaluation should be a part of all product development. What is Fatigue ? In materials science, Fatigue is the progressive and localized structural damage that occurs when a material is subjected to cyclic loading (material is stressed repeatedly).
